Regulated by the New York Department of Financial Services (NYDFS), RLUSD is that controlled vehicle. It's a way to introduce traditional financial institutions to the benefits of blockchain – speed, lower fees (we're talking fractions of a penny!), and transparency – without scaring them off with the inherent risks of completely decentralized systems.

Compliance Breeds Trust And Institutional Interest
And that’s important, because it’s the difference between a playground experiment and a serious financial instrument. This entails that we do public, transparent, reserve attestations. We make sure that each RLUSD is actually backed 1-to-1 by real-world, low-risk assets like U.S. dollar deposits and short-term U.S. treasuries.
This isn't some fly-by-night operation. This is a very strategic play by Ripple to gain institution’s trust. And it's working. And it looks like Bank of America (BofA) is already getting onboard. Imagine the possibilities: cross-border payments settled in seconds for a fraction of the cost, institutional lending powered by blockchain transparency, and a whole new world of DeFi opportunities opening up to businesses that have been hesitant to enter the space.
- Faster Transactions: 3-5 seconds confirmation.
- Lower Fees: Approximately $0.0002 per transaction.
- High Scalability: Over 1,500 transactions per second.

With RLUSD’s presence on Ethereum, it greatly expands RLUSD’s audience. This launch greatly increases the capacity for DeFi integrations, such as trading, yield farming, staking, and loans on XRPL as well as Ethereum. This dual-chain approach maximizes accessibility and utility.
